STM8控制74HC595的问题!!!

2019-07-15 10:08发布

现在玩一个项目,STM8S005K6芯片连接18个595,控制864个LED,一个595的输出口并联6个LED灯。
现在要做成火焰的效果,小火的时候问题不大,但是中火和大火(LED灯亮的多,也闪)MCU好像会自动复位,跟硬件有关系吗??小火的时候电流1.3A左右,中火电流2.5A,大火3A以上。
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
17条回答
小S咯
1楼-- · 2019-07-17 05:45
music_mc 发表于 2017-7-23 14:49
明显功率不足,哪有那么多问题,换个电源完事

有个新问题,595上电乱码。刚上电的时候MCU像死机一样不会执行程序,LED灯随机亮,要断电上电几次才会有一次是正常执行程序,有什么解决方法吗?
小S咯
2楼-- · 2019-07-17 06:46
人中狼 发表于 2017-7-24 10:31
首先要确保你的电源功率足够,根据你现在的情况,仍然是电源功率不足的状态,估计能正常启动单片机的情况就是LED亮的少的时候,电源最好是12伏,3安的。
其次,595有一个输出使能引脚,可以控制595并口的输出状态,虽然这个引脚能够控制595的并口状态,但是前提也是单片机能正常运行。
所以还是要先解决电源功率的问题,如 ...

确实,我用示波器看供电两端的电压,LED亮的少的时候,12V很小的毛刺,一旦灯亮的多了,会下降到10V。
人中狼
3楼-- · 2019-07-17 10:56
不知道你的电路是怎么设计的,也不知道你的电源功率是多少,如果更换电源不方便的话,可以更换LED的限流电阻,在可以接受的LED亮度下降低LED的电流,也就可以降低整体的功耗,不过假设一个LED一个限流电阻的话,那就是更换864个,工作量也不小。
小S咯
4楼-- · 2019-07-17 12:04
 精彩回答 2  元偷偷看……
人中狼
5楼-- · 2019-07-17 16:23
595上电乱码很正常,很多器件在上电时都会是随即状态,所以单片机启动后,一般都要对外部芯片做初始化。

一周热门 更多>